I find your posting very interesting... I have many Donovan's they arrived in Quebec City circa 1820, some further left and went to the States. They travelled down to NH and VT to work in the lumber camps, most returned, but some stayed. I also have Quinlan's. Here is some of what I have: 1. MICHAEL2 DONOVAN (UNKNOWN1) was born Abt. 1785 in co.Tipperary, Ireland. He married MARGARET EGAN. She was born Abt. 1787 in co.Tipperary, Ireland. Children of MICHAEL DONOVAN and MARGARET EGAN are: i. MICHAEL3 DONOVAN, b. Abt. 1800; m. LOUISE CARRIER, Notre Dame de Quebec, Quebec City, Quebec; b. Abt. 1800. More About MICHAEL DONOVAN and LOUISE CARRIER: Marriage: Notre Dame de Quebec, Quebec City, Quebec 2. ii. DENIS DONOVAN, b. Abt. 1801, co.Tipperary, Ireland; d. Bef. 1865, Quebec, Canada. 3. iii. ELEANOR DONOVAN, b. 1805, co.Tipperary, Ireland; d. Bef. 1872, Ste. Catherine de Portneuf, Quebec. 4. iv. JOHN DONOVAN, b. Abt. 1807, co.Tipperary, Ireland; d. Bef. 1834, Ste.Catherine De Portneuf, Quebec. 5. v. WILLIAM DONOVAN, b. Abt. 1811, co.Tipperary, Ireland. 6. vi. JEREMIAH DONOVAN, b. Abt. 1813. 7. vii. MARGARET DONOVAN, b. Abt. 1816. There is a lot more, but I also have a few Denis, Honora and Jeremiah. In Quinlan I have Thomas b. 1805 married to Hannah Corrigan.
